Upgrading From 50mb To 100mb

Can someone please help.

Just been on the phone to Virgin, thought i would upgrade my broadband from 50mb to 100mb after finding out that the 100mb was now live in my area.

Thought it would be a simple thing, but no, Virgin dont do simple

First i was told "yes that will be fine, i will also send you a FREE TiVo box out" but it will be £49.99 connection fee

Told them that i already had a TiVo box and also 2 other boxes in the bedrooms, so i was not really bothered about another TiVo box, and by the way £49.99 is not FREE whichever way you dress it up.

Then got put on hold for about 20 minutes while he had a discussion, then said o.k. to upgrade to the 100mb would be an extra £27 per month
told him it was funny that, as on their site it was only £10 a month difference between 50mb and 100mb so was the other £17 going to some charity of his choice

Another 5 minutes and we were at an extra £10 per month but £49.99 installation and he could fit me in for an engineer to come out the first week in January. When i asked why would i need a engineer when i already had 50mb and the super hub, he said that the engineer had to connect something to the router

Why is everything such a pain when ever you want to upgrade or change packages with Virgin?

Last time i upgraded my package, it took me months to get Virgin to admit that i was being overcharged by nearly £50 per month, am i in the running for another bout with them?

When I upgraded from 50Mb to 100Mb I was also changing from the VMNG300 to the Superhub.

Delivery was within 5 days. The guy who delivered the SH was just that, a delivery man. I said to him that I wanted the SH to be in modem only mode. He said, "What's that!" He said he didn't know anything about computers or networks. All he did for me was ring back to base give the SH Mac number and my postal address and that was it.

I asked him if he needed to see if the SH was working before he left. "No. I've done my bit. Ring customer services if you have a problem." I was left to establish that I had an internet connection and to figure out setting up modem mode myself.

Compared with the service given when I first had 50Mb this was dreadful. That time the guy stayed until everything was working and a speed test over 40Mb was achieved, even though it was his first 50Mb installation.

So, in my case, there was no need for a tech. Instructions for getting the right config sent to your SH could be sent in the box with the SH or mail. Installation costs to VM were next to nothing. There should be no charge for installation.
